This is an extension method on `IServiceCollection`. It registers NodeServices with ASP.NET Core's DI system. Typically you should call this from the `ConfigureServices` method in your `Startup.cs` file.

* `ProjectPath` - if specified, controls the working directory used when launching Node instances. This affects, for example, the location that `require` statements resolve relative paths against. If not specified, your application root directory is used.
|
||||
* `WatchFileExtensions` - if specified, the launched Node instance will watch for changes to any files with these extensions, and auto-restarts when any are changed.
